About Michigan Top Team
Michigan Top Team, situated at 22222 Telegraph Road in Southfield, Michigan, stands as a premier mixed martial arts and fitness facility. Strategically located between 8 Mile Rd and 9 Mile Rd, the gym provides accessible training opportunities for individuals across the region. Founded in 2013 by Daron Cruickshank, a professional fighter celebrated for his tenure in the UFC and current participation in Rizin, Michigan Top Team has become a hub for both aspiring and established combat sports athletes. Training Programs and Classes
Michigan Top Team offers a comprehensive array of programs tailored to suit various interests and skill levels. These include:
- MMA Competition Team: This program is designed for serious competitors looking to hone their skills in professional and amateur MMA. Training encompasses a wide range of disciplines, including boxing, kickboxing, and no-gi jiu-jitsu grappling.
- All-Level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u: Catering to both beginners and experienced practitioners, the BJJ program includes gi and no-gi training. A structured belt ranking system is in place for both children and adults, providing a clear path for progression and achievement.
- Striking Program: This program covers a spectrum of striking arts, including boxing, Muay Thai, kickboxing, and MMA striking techniques. Participants learn fundamental striking skills, footwork, and defensive maneuvers.
- Little Ninjas Program: Specifically designed for children aged 5-12, this program introduces youngsters to the fundamentals of self-defense through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u and kickboxing. Beyond physical skills, the program focuses on building confidence, discipline, and respect.

Affiliation with Adopt a Cop Program
Michigan Top Team proudly supports the Adopt a Cop program, offering free or reduced training for police officers. This initiative recognizes the dedication and sacrifices of law enforcement personnel, providing them with access to high-quality martial arts and fitness training. Membership Options and Pricing
Michigan Top Team offers flexible membership options to accommodate various needs and budgets. Unlimited classes are available for $149 per month, with no long-term contracts required. Discounts are offered to military personnel, police officers, first responders, and veterans, recognizing their service and dedication. Drop-in options are also available, with day passes priced at $20, week passes at $85, and monthly passes at $170.
Birthday Party Packages
The gym also offers birthday party packages, starting at $300, providing a unique and exciting celebration option. These packages include structured martial arts classes, bounce houses, and other add-ons, making for a memorable and active birthday experience.
